Typical Bifold Door Problems and Their Solutions
In this section, we'll cover prevalent problems that might happen with bifold doors, along with their possible fixes.
1. Jamming or Sticking Doors
Description: Bifold doors might jam or stick, making them hard to open and close efficiently.
Causes:
- Dirt accumulation in the tracks
- Misalignment of the door panels
- Deforming due to humidity or temperature level modifications
Solutions:
- Cleaning the Tracks: Use a vacuum or a moist cloth to remove debris and dirt from the tracks.
- Straightening Doors: Check the alignment of the door panels and make necessary changes utilizing the hinges.
- Humidity Control: In locations with high humidity, using a dehumidifier can assist manage door warping.
2. Doors Not Closing Properly
Description: Sometimes, bifold doors do not close all the way, creating gaps that can impact insulation and security.
Causes:
- Loose hardware
- Irregular floor covering
- Deterioration of seals or gaskets
Solutions:
- Tightening Hardware: Check all screws and tighten any loose parts to make sure the door closes appropriately.
- Checking Flooring: Confirm whether the floor covering is even. If not, think about modifications that may entail leveling or changing sections.
- Replacing Seals: Inspect seals and gaskets for damage and replace them when required.
3. Broken Rollers
Description: Bifold doors are typically fitted with rollers at their top and bottom. If one or more rollers break, it can result in problem in operation.
Causes:
- Natural wear and tear over time
- Physical damage due to impact or excessive weight
Solutions:
- Replacing Rollers: Consult the manufacturer's specs for appropriate replacement rollers. A lot of roller assemblies can be easily eliminated with common tools and changed.
- Regular Maintenance: Lubricate rollers regularly to lower wear and extend their life-span.
4. Broken or Broken Glass Panels
Description: Glass panels can become split or shattered due to effects or extreme temperatures.
Causes:
- Accidental hits
- Temperature extremes triggering thermal tension
Solutions:
- Professional Replacement: For security factors, it is recommended to have actually broken or broken glass panels changed by professionals.
- Shatterproof Glass Installations: Upgrade to tempered shatterproof glass to minimize the risk of future damage.

Preventative Maintenance Tips
To keep bifold doors operating smoothly, regular maintenance is essential. Here are some useful t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Thoroughly clean the door tracks every couple of months to avoid dirt buildup.
- Inspect Hardware: Periodically inspect screws, hinges, and bolts to guarantee they are safe and secure.
- Lubricate Moving Parts: Use a silicone-based lube on rollers and hinges to enable smooth operation.
- Display Humidity Levels: Use a dehumidifier in damp conditions to prevent door warping.
- Inspect Seals: Inspect gaskets and seals regularly to guarantee they're in excellent condition, replacing them as necessary.
